Bring up your source PDF in Acrobat. Click the Thumbnails tab so that you see representations of the individual pages. On the source document right-mouse click the page you want, choose Extract and the page(s) you want. It will create a new PDF document that you may then File -> Save.

Here is the general procedure to use: 1). Open the original PDF file in Adobe Reader, or in another PDF Reader application. 2). Select 'Print' and choose a range of pages and Win2PDF as the printer. Print a range of pages from PDF Viewer. 3). Save the results of this subset of pages as a new PDF file (e.g., "newfile.pdf").
